Annabelle C. (Cinefra) Adams Obituary

Annabelle Cinefra Adams, of Brownsville, PA, passed away peacefully on February 10, 2025.


 She was born on Friday July 9, 1937, in Pittsburgh, PA, to Vincenzo and Rose (Salvino) Cinefra.


Annabelle was a devoted Mother, Nana, and friend. She cherished her family above all else, especially her grandchildren and great grandchildren: Brittany, Russ, Oliver, Murphy and great grandbaby-on-the-way Emerson; Gabriela Adams, Andrew Adams, Anthony Adams, and Dominic Adams; Tyler (Marie Dishian) Parrish; Alex, Emily and great grandbaby-on-the-way Adams, and Elise Adams. She leaves behind a legacy of love and warmth that will be deeply missed.


She is survived by her children, Eugene Jr. (Blanca) Adams; Diana (Jim) Parrish; Kenneth Adams; and Daniel (Lisa) Adams.


Annabelle was preceded in death by her beloved husband, Eugene B. Adams, Sr.; her parents; her sisters, Mathilda Morch and Catherine Connors; her brother, Frank Cinefra and daughter in law, Anita Adams.


A devout member of the United Christian Church Disciples of Christ in Coal Center, Annabelle’s faith was a cornerstone of her life. She found joy in her church community and cherished the friendships she made at The Oaks at the Center in the Woods. The family would like to extend a special thank you to the compassionate staff at The Grove in Washington for their exceptional care.


Friends and family will be received in the Mariscotti Funeral Home, Inc., 323 Fourth Street, California, PA, Anthony N. Mariscotti, Supervisor, on Sunday February 16, 2025, from 2-7 pm.


A funeral service will begin at 9 am on Monday in the funeral home with Rev. Amory Merriman, Officiating.


Interment will follow in St. Joseph Cemetery, 8th Street, Verona, PA 15147.
